MAGIC BINDS BY ILONA ANDREWS

magic binds cover
The new, “heart-stopping”* novel in the New York Times bestselling series that “defines urban fantasy.”*

Mercenary Kate Daniels knows all too well that magic in post-Shift Atlanta is a dangerous business. But nothing she’s faced could have prepared her for this…

Kate and the former Beast Lord Curran Lennart are finally making their relationship official. But there are some steep obstacles standing in the way of their walk to the altar…

Kate’s father, Roland, has kidnapped the demigod Saiman and is slowly bleeding him dry in his never-ending bid for power. A Witch Oracle has predicted that if Kate marries the man she loves, Atlanta will burn and she will lose him forever. And the only person Kate can ask for help is long dead.

The odds are impossible. The future is grim. But Kate Daniels has never been one to play by the rules…

BOOK DESCRIPTION COURTESY OF AMAZON

I was given a copy of this book for an honest review.

Magic Binds (Kate Daniels) will take you on a roller coaster of a ride!! After claiming Atlanta, Kate now has to defend it and keep it from her Father. Now Roland has taken one of Atlanta’s citizens, Saiman. Kate must save Saiman and prevent the prediction from coming true. She needs to talk to her Aunt and find out how to stop her Father, Roland. Plus she has to plan her wedding to Curran. I love this series, and this book. There were some parts of the book that seemed to be a little slower paced, but over all the book was really good. It still has the humor and Kate snarkyness. So, I give MAGIC BINDS 4/5 STARS. It would have been 5, except for it slowing down in some spots. I recommend this series if you have not read it.

UNRAVELED BLOG TOUR

SPIDER

About UNRAVELED:
What could go wrong when you’re trying to unravel a decades-old conspiracy?
 
As the current queen of the Ashland underworld, you would think that I, Gin Blanco, would know all about some secret society controlling things from behind the scenes. I might be the Spider, the city’s most fearsome assassin, but all my Ice and Stone elemental magic hasn’t done me a lick of good in learning more about “the Circle”. Despite my continued investigations, the trail’s gone as cold as the coming winter.
 
So when Finnegan Lane, my foster brother, gets word of a surprising inheritance, we figure why not skip town for someplace less dangerous for a few days? That place: Bullet Pointe, a fancy hotel resort complex plus Old West theme park that Finn now owns lock, stock, and barrel. At first, all the struttin’ cowboys and sassy saloon girls are just hokey fun. But add in some shady coincidences and Circle assassins lurking all around, and vacationing becomes wilder—and deadlier—than any of us expected.
 
Good thing this assassin brought plenty of knives to the gunfight…

Excerpt!
UNRAVELED –

Since Fedora was already past the gate, I didn’t have time to ease out of the van, sneak through the shadows, and stab the giants in the back the way I normally would have.

Thus I kicked my door open, barreled out of the vehicle, and started running down the street toward the SUV.

“Gin! Wait!” Phillip shouted, scrambling to get out and follow me.

But I needed to get to the man in the mansion before Fedora did, so I tuned him out. The giants whirled around at the sound of Phillip’s voice and spotted me racing toward them. They cursed, pulled guns out from underneath their trench coats, and snapped up the weapons.

Pfft! Pfft! Pfft!

I zigzagged, and the first round of bullets went wide. But when the giants paused to take more careful aim, I reached for my Stone magic and hardened my skin into an impenetrable shell.

Pfft! Pfft! Pfft!

The second round of bullets also went wide. The giants had come prepared, and the silencers on the ends of their weapons muffled the sounds of the shots. No lights snapped on inside the neighboring mansions. They wanted to keep this quiet, well, so did I.

Pfft! Pfft! Pfft!

Two of the bullets went wide, but the third punched into my right shoulder, spinning me around. Still, thanks to my magic, it didn’t blast through me the way it would have otherwise. I skidded on the ice coating the street, but I managed to regain my balance and charge forward again.

REVIEW

I was given a copy of this book by Netgalley for an honest review.

Unraveled (Elemental Assassin) is a roller coaster of a ride! The characters and story line is very well-developed. The Scooby gang, Gin, Fin, Owen, and Bria, go to check out the inheritance that his mother supposedly left him. Fin apparently inherited an Old West Theme Park. Now can you picture Gin in an Old West Theme Park? Me either! When they get there, Gin thinks she sees a member of the Circle. Could the Theme Park be a front for the Circle? As you know, every time Gin and the gang plan a vacation, things don’t always work out. Gin always ends up with bodies piling up everywhere she goes. This is no different. This book has all of Gin’s sass, grit, and snarkyness. If you have not read this series I highly recommend it. I recommend this book to everyone. I give UNRAVELED 5/5 STARS.

FLIGHT FROM MAYHAM BY YASMINE GALENORN

flight from mayhem cover
New York Times bestselling author Yasmine Galenorn presents the second Fly by Night novel, set in the realm of the Otherworld.

I’m Shimmer, a blue dragon shifter. Thanks to a mistake, I was exiled from the Dragon Reaches and sentenced to work for gorgeous, exasperating Alex Radcliffe, a vampire who owns the Fly by Night Magical Investigations Agency. Every time I turn around, somebody’s trying to kill us. But you know what they say: All’s fair in love and bounty hunting…

A serial killer is stalking the elderly Fae of Seattle, draining their bank accounts before brutally murdering them. When Chase Johnson asks for our help, Alex and I discover that the sociopath is also a shifter—able to change shape to match his victim’s deepest desires. Our friend and colleague Bette volunteers to act as bait, but the plan goes dangerously awry. Now, unless we find her first, she’s about to face her worst nightmare.

From the Paperback edition.

BOOK DESCRIPTION COURTESY OF AMAZON

I was given a copy of this book by Netgalley for an honest review.

Flight from Mayhem (Fly by Night) is an awesome book! The characters and story line is very well-developed. When Shimmer and the others delve into a case where someone is killing older Fae and stealing their money. One of their own is put into danger. They will face something they have never seen before. They cannot believe everything they see, for the shifter can take on the life of anyone. Also, the house across the street has a mystery that they have to solve to help the ghost stuck there. I loved this book and series, and recommend it to everyone. I give FLIGHT FROM MAYHEM 5/5 STARS.

BLOOD OF THE EARTH BY FAITH HUNTER

blood of the earth coverSet in the same world as the New York Times bestselling Jane Yellowrock novels, an all-new series starring Nell Ingram, who wields powers as old as the earth.

When Nell Ingram met skinwalker Jane Yellowrock, she was almost alone in the world, exiled by both choice and fear from the cult she was raised in, defending herself with the magic she drew from her deep connection to the forest that surrounds her.

Now, Jane has referred Nell to PsyLED, a Homeland Security agency policing paranormals, and agent Rick LaFleur has shown up at Nell’s doorstep. His appearance forces her out of her isolated life into an investigation that leads to the vampire Blood Master of Nashville.

Nell has a team—and a mission. But to find the Master’s kidnapped vassal, Nell and the PsyLED team will be forced to go deep into the heart of the very cult Nell fears, infiltrating the cult and a humans-only terrorist group before time runs out…

From the Paperback edition.

BOOK DESCRIPTION COURTESY OF AMAZON

I was given a copy of this book by Netgalley for an honest review.

Blood of the Earth (A Soulwood Novel) is a great start to a new series! This is a spin-off of the Jane Yellowrock series. I have not read a book by Faith Hunter that I did not like. I don’t think she could write a bad novel! Rick LaFleur shows up on Nell’s doorstep per Jane’s referral.   His clues to the where about of the Nashville Blood Master. It has led him to the cult that Nell had once belonged to not far from her property that she lives at. I love the characters in this book, and seeing Lafleur and the others that are with him.  When I started this book, I could not put it down. If you have not enjoyed a Faith Hunter book, I urge you to go out and get your copy today. You will not be disappointed. I give BLOOD OF THE EARTH 5/5 STARS.
